Transaction f66acf4015f504065afb5655dd8114a12b09e814a5f1e6fdb73076c32025a599
1 Input
1 Output
-
f66acf4015f504065afb5655dd8114a12b09e814a5f1e6fdb73076c32025a599:0
- value
- 3288767
- script pubkey
- OP_0 OP_PUSHBYTES_32 c805e3e9a653c4ee4e258c8803b14115254f0525d5331689e3bb48264ed56604
- address
- bc1qeqz786dx20zwun393jyq8v2pz5j57pf965e3dz0rhdyzvnk4vczqyuc27x